11 nabbed in Mandaue, Lapu drug raids

By: Norman V. Mendoza October 24,2014 - 05:28 AM

Eleven persons were arrested by police in separate drug bust operations done in the cities of Mandaue and Lapu-Lapu last Tuesday and Wednesday.

First to fall was 38-year-old Rico Cuizon, a resident of barangay Pusok, Lapu-Lapu City. Found in his possession was one sachet of shabu last Tuesday evening.

The Marigondon Police Station arrested Ramilito Amodia, Rolly Orivenes and Bernie Batusin, after they were caught selling shabu to a police decoy in a buy bust operation also conducted last Tuesday evening.

Taken from them were seven sachets of suspected shabu and one .357 revolver.

At past 12 midnight Wednesday, police arrested 45-year-old Vicente Malinao, a resident of barangay Babag, Lapu-Lapu City who yielded 10 sachets of shabu.

Later in the day, the City Anti-illegal Drugs Special Operation Task Group (CAIDSOTG) of Lapu-Lapu City arrested suspects Jonathan Tampus, 43, Alber Tapao, 26, Mark Anthony Gonzales, 31, all residents of barangay Marigondon.

Taken from them were four small plastic sachets of suspected shabu and the P200 marked money were confiscated from them.

In Mandaue City, the Casuntingan police precinct arrested Gerry Basig, 24, a resident of barangay Maguikay, Jan-Jan Villarta of barangay Umapad and Carlo Maglasang, of barangay Alang-Alang for possession of seven sachets of shabu.
